hydraulic orbital motor OMV800,BMV800 drive motor with tapered shaft for beet harvesters
The HANJIU OMV800,BMV800 hydraulic gerotor motor is installed on Holmer and Ropa sugar beet harvesters,
type code no.272115
Details as below
Geometrical displacement (cm3/r): 801.8
Max. Speed (min-1 [rpm]): 250/300
Max. Torque (Nm [lbf·in]): 1880 [16640]
Max. Output (kW [hp]): 42.5 [57.0]
Max. Oil flow (l/min [USgal/ min]): 200 [52.8]
Max. Inlet pressure (bar [psi]): 210 [3050]
Main Specifications:
Type | BMV 315 | BMV 400 | BMV 500 | BMV 630 | BMV 800 | BMV 1000 | |
Geometric displacement (cm3 /rev.) | 333 | 419 | 518 | 666 | 801 | 990 | |
Max. speed (rpm) | cont. | 510 | 500 | 400 | 320 | 250 | 200 |
int. | 630 | 600 | 480 | 380 | 300 | 240 | |
Max. torque (N·m) | cont. | 920 | 1180 | 1460 | 1660 | 1880 | 2015 |
int. | 1110 | 1410 | 1760 | 1940 | 2110 | 2280 | |
peak | 1290 | 1640 | 2050 | 2210 | 2470 | 2400 | |
Max. output (kW) | cont. | 38 | 47 | 47 | 40 | 33 | 28.6 |
int. | 46 | 56 | 56 | 56 | 44 | 40 | |
Max. pressure drop (MPa) | cont. | 20 | 20 | 20 | 18 | 16 | 14 |
int. | 24 | 24 | 24 | 21 | 18 | 16 | |
peak | 28 | 28 | 28 | 24 | 21 | 18 | |
Max. flow (L/min) | cont. | 160 | 200 | 200 | 200 | 200 | 200 |
int. | 200 | 240 | 240 | 240 | 240 | 240 | |
Weight (kg) | 31.8 | 32.6 | 33.5 | 34.9 | 36.5 | 38.6 |
orbital motor is widely used in several core systems of harvesters:
Walking drive system: In the hydrostatic transmission system, it utilizes its low-speed and high-torque characteristics to drive the walking wheels or tracks of the harvester either directly or through a simple deceleration mechanism. By adjusting the hydraulic oil flow, the travel speed can be infinitely adjusted to ensure the flexibility and stability of the machine in complex terrain such as slopes and mud.
Cutting platform control system: Provide strong and smooth driving force for the rapid elevation of the cutting platform, and support the automatic profiling function of the cutting platform according to the terrain (control the elevation cylinder).
Material Conveyor System: Drive the conveyor chain, agitator, elevator and other mechanisms between the cutting platform to the threshing drum and the cleaning device to the grain bin to provide continuous and stable speed and torque to ensure the smooth and unobstructed flow of crop materials.
Attachment drives: for bin unloading agitators, straw chopping devices or baling devices, etc. The modular design facilitates integration and installation.
